Snowpack studies see grim future

Dwindling snowpack, earlier stream flow and rising temperatures in the Western United States can be attributed directly to human activity and will seriously affect California’s water supply, perhaps in a matter of decades, according to new research.

Major quake on Hayward fault more likely, scientists say

As if we needed another reason to fear the Hayward Fault, earthquake experts gathered in San Francisco Tuesday provided two: It’s longer and mightier than once thought; and it is connected to the restless Calaveras Fault that runs through Santa Clara County’s east foothills.
